Ash to play ‘Free All Angels’ anniversary gigs with Charlotte Hatherley - ticket details
The band reunite as a quartet to play a set of special shows.
Ash are to play a series of special gigs this autumn.
The trio, celebrating the tenth anniversary of their 'Free All Angels' album, will head across the country playing the album in full, as well as an additional 'Best Of' setlist to celebrate their upcoming retrospective album. Former guitarist Charlotte Hatherley, who left the band in 2006, has been confirmed to join Ash again on the tour.
The band's Best Of record, 'The Best Of Ash', is released on CD and CD/DVD on 17th October. As well as tracks spanning their career, the DVD also features previously unseen tour documentary ‘Teenage Wildlife’.
